【6】nagios从零学习使用 - centreon发送邮件报警
生活随笔
收集整理的這篇文章主要介紹了
【6】nagios从零学习使用 - centreon发送邮件报警
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
通過郵件發送報警信息給139郵箱,這樣隨時隨地都可以了解服務器情況。
在網上查一段時間資料,發現在mutt+msmtp這樣的組合最簡單方便。
郵件客戶端安裝設置如下:
msmtp下載 http://sourceforge.net/projects/msmtp/files/msmtp/ tar -jxvf x.tar.bz2 msmtp編譯 ./configure --prefix=/usr/local/msmtp make make install cd /usr/local/msmtp mkdir etc cd etc vi msmtprc 創建配置文件,內容如下: host smtp.163.com from 82831221@163.com auth login user 82831221 password 163郵箱的密碼 #明文顯示 logfile /var/log/msmtp.log #日志文件 安裝mutt及設置Muttrc yum install mutt vi /etc/Muttrc realname要發送的郵件名 set editor="vi" set realname="82831221@163.com" #msmtp配置的郵件地址 set sendmail="/usr/local/msmtp/bin/msmtp" set use_from=yes 注意: mutt發信時會在/root/下面寫入send文件。 把/root/sent文件添加所有人都有寫權限 chmod 777 /root chmod 777 /root/sent 發送例子: echo "hi,all" | mutt -s "bt" -c 153785587@qq.commutt發信不成功的原因,請參考:
http://cwind.blog.51cto.com/62582/1157525
還是不要更改/root目錄權限,所以上面的Muttrc配置文件更改一下sent文件存放路徑。
效果如圖:
下面開始設置報警:
1、修改模板讓他可以直接報警,這樣就不用一臺一臺機設置,服務與主機模板設置一樣
2、使用mutt發送郵件,添加報警命令。
把原來的email內容改成如下:
3、修改聯系人方式
5、隨便添加一臺不存在的主機
報警信息:
轉載于:https://blog.51cto.com/hxw168/1389588
總結
以上是生活随笔為你收集整理的【6】nagios从零学习使用 - centreon发送邮件报警的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: qq邮箱使用outlook 2007
- 下一篇: HDFS应用场景、部署、原理与基本架构